The real story

Long-term residents consistently report Sedona Place as a warm, activity-rich community where management knows residents by name and hosts regular events like game nights and holiday parties. Recent management changes have introduced friction: several residents cite broken security gates, rent hikes paired with reduced staffing, and communication lapses, though the current team appears to be addressing these issues.

Recent shift: Management transition approximately one year ago initially caused service decline (broken gates, reduced staffing, communication gaps); current management team (Gabi, Lina, Erika) appears to have stabilized operations and improved resident communication in recent months.

Common questions

Can I bring my pet?
Yes, Sedona Place is pet-friendly, according to their website and resident reviews.
What activities are available?
The activity director organizes frequent events including game nights, holiday parties, day trips, and Super Bowl viewing parties.
